Commercial Slab Construction in Sarasota, FL
Commercial slab construction services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ete foundations for various types of commercial buildings, including warehouses, retail centers, office complexes,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require durable, level conc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for structural components and flooring. Property owners interested in this service should understand the importance of proper site preparation, soil assessment, and the specific load requirements of their project to ensure a stable and long-lasting foundation.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ners often want to know about the scope of work involved, including excavation, formwork, reinforcement, and concrete pouring processes. It’s also helpful to consider factors such as local building codes, potential soil conditions, and the intended use of the space, which can influence the design and materials used. Clear communication about project specifications and site conditions can help facilitate a smooth construction process and a foundation that meets the needs of the property.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on property sites.
How thick should a commercial slab be for different uses? Thickness varies based on load requirements, typically ranging from 4 to 8 inches, depending on the specific application and vehicle weight.
What factors influence the durability of a commercial concrete slab? Proper soil preparation, quality materials, and adequate reinforcement contribute to the long-lasting performance of a slab.
Is site preparation important before pouring a commercial slab? Yes, thorough site preparation ensures a stable base, proper drainage, and reduces the risk of cracking or shifting over time.
